Licenses
To work with electricity for an employer, an electrician must be licensed by the state. The license requirements vary by the state however, they all include gaining the necessary knowledge and experience, obtaining training through classroom study and on-the-job experiences, and passing national and state-level examinations.
The license requirements vary by the type of work an Electrician bedford performs. For instance an appliance installer needs to have a different license than a lineman and a wireman since each of these jobs requires an individual level of competence and training.
For commercial projects, an electrician needs a master electrician license. The person who holds the license is responsible for ensuring that the electrical equipment is in compliance with specifications of the code and that the installation is secure and safe for workers and the public.
Before an electrician can start work on a construction site, he or she must apply for a building permit. The responsibility of determining whether the work is in conformity with local and county code is on the Building Code Official.
To obtain a Building Permit you must submit a complete request for a permit. The application must include details about the building as well as the project that is being constructed. The applicant must sign and date the application. The building permit must be kept on the town office's file and on the town website.
If a property owner is requesting an entirely new commercial or residential building permit, he has to pay the Adequate Facilities Tax (AFT) before the application can be processed. This tax is collected by the Bedford County Building Codes Department and is a once-off fee.
The AFT helps finance the maintenance costs of the Town of Bedford infrastructure and buildings including fire protection systems as well as water supply disposal, public safety, waste disposal parks and recreation sidewalks, streets, and other services. The AdFT also helps pay for the staffing and operation costs of the Building Codes Department.

Education for the future
Continuing education is an important aspect of keeping your license and staying up-to-date on the latest industry information. The continuing education classes you take can help you to improve your abilities and knowledge of the electrical industry, which could result in a better-paying job and more opportunities for advancement.
Each two-year period of renewal for electrician licenses licensed electrician must complete eight hours of continuing education. The hours can be taken via online or other learning methods.

The Board can conduct an audit of continuing education compliance at any time during the renewal period. Your license could be suspended if you fail to complete your continuing education within the specified time. You could also be subject to an amount of $1,000 in fines.
The most efficient way to ensure that you're getting the most value from your continuing education is to pick courses that have clear objectives and that are supported by an official Certificate of Completion, or other evidence of completion. These documents must be kept by the licensee for a minimum of five years following the completion of the course.
Continuous education courses should improve the capacity of a licensee to perform their work safely and effectively. They should cover topics such as safety regulations, code updates and other regulatory or technical issues that are relevant to their work.
